| General Song Notes: - |
| Was alternately known as Free My Soul during live performances prior to the release of Redneck Wonderland. |
|   |
| Production Details: - |
| Produced by Warne Livesey and Midnight Oil. Recorded at Sing Sing Studios, Melbourne. Assistant engineers - Dave Davis and Matt Voigt. Mixed by Warne Livesey at Sing Sing, 301 Sydney and b.j.g. London. Assistants at b.j.g - Alex Clark and James Wagstaff |
